Abstract
The Cs 2 3 3 Σ g + state, which was observed previously by two-photon excitation [D. Li, F. Xie, Li Li, S. Magnier, V.B. Sovkov, V.S. Ivanov, Chem. Phys. Lett. 441 (2007) 39], has been observed by infrared–infrared (IR–IR) double resonance spectroscopy. One hundred and seventy IR–IR double resonance lines have been assigned to transitions into the 3 3 Σ g + v = 2–12 levels. Hyperfine structure of this state has been resolved in the excitation spectra. Molecular constants and the potential energy curve of this state are reported in this Letter.
